Silver Moon Ranch Tract 16
Tract 16 is located along County N3630 Road. This land is raw, undeveloped land with moderate to heavey tree cover and plenty of open pasture land, especially along the eastern side of this land just across the creek. There is a small wet weather creek that winds through this property along the western side of the land. The previous owner established a small drive into this property for access. They had a modular home located near the front of the property at one time. We had the property cleaned up recently, so you will see a clearing near the power pole and several other cleared areas that have been cleaned up. A power pole is established and a well was installed, however we do not know the condition of the well. We highly recommend having the well inspected and you will need to install a pump at your expense. Septic would need to be installed by the new owner at their expense as well if you are going to establish a residence. This scenic property is located in Okfuskee County, approximately 5 miles northeast of Paden, Oklahoma, 63 miles east of Oklahoma City, Oklahoma, and 75 miles southwest of Tulsa, Oklahoma.
WHAT IS THE PROPERTY ZONED AND WHAT ARE THE PROPERTY TAXES FOR A PARCEL?
The zoning allows Residential/Recreational. The approximate annual property taxes are less than $25 per acre per year and are current.
